Click It Local’s mission is to secure the future of the local high street by making it easier for people to shop more locally, and regularly. With this in mind, they have teamed up with traders at Broadway Market to create an online platform that will function as a virtual market. Running alongside the traditional physical stalls, the virtual market will let people order online for same-day or next-day delivery, as well as pre-order their weekly favourites for collection on Saturdays from the Click & Collect stall. The collection point will be at the top of the market, clearly signposted and manned by Click It Local staff.
By allowing customers to pre-order products, this not only offers locals a more convenient service but it will also help reduce queues and contribute to the safe reopening of the market.

The Click It Local app will follow next month but customers can start ordering for delivering and pre-ordering for collection via the website now.

Stalls that locals can shop at through Broadway Market virtually include; Climpson & Sons, La Bouche, Ted’s Veg, Downland Produce, S-Gerth, Artisan Foods, German Deli, Karma Queen, Jackpot Peanut Butter, Jess It Up, Meringue Girls, My Eco Order, Shea Alchemy, Lucy Lynch gifts, The Olive Oil co. and House of Buckley.Delivery costs £3 if you order from one retailer, delivered anywhere within their East London radius. However, what sets Click It Local apart from many other similar delivery services, is that a customer can order from multiple retailers and have it all delivered to their door in one consolidated order, each extra retailer adding £1 to the delivery charge.
